Andaman and Nicobar Islands/hotels in india/India/Narlai/Kunchaman Tourist Attractions



Andaman and Nicobar Islands/hotels in india/India/Narlai/Kunchaman Tourist Places


Andaman and Nicobar Islands/hotels in india/India/Narlai/Kunchaman Tour Packages
Andaman and Nicobar Islands/hotels in india/India/Narlai/Kunchaman Hotels